Types of Windows and Doors
When choosing doors and windows, consumers have myriad alternatives. Below are a few of the most typical classifications:
Windows
- Sash Windows: Hinged on one side and opens external.
- Double-Hung Windows: Comprising two movable sashes that move vertically.
- Sliding Windows: Feature several panels that slide horizontally.
- Bay Windows: Extend beyond the exterior wall, offering additional area and light.
- Picture Windows: Large, set windows that provide unobstructed views.
- Awning Windows: Hinged at the top, these windows open external to create an awning effect.
Doors
- Entry Doors: Front doors typically designed for durability and curb appeal.
- Patio Doors: Sliding or hinged doors that connect outdoor and indoor spaces.
- French Doors: Double doors that swing open from the center, typically utilized as entrances to outdoor patios or gardens.
- Bi-Fold Doors: Foldable doors that open wide to create extensive openings.
- Storm Doors: Additional doors set up in front of entry doors for added defense versus weather condition.
Advantages of Quality Windows and Doors
Buying professionally-manufactured doors and windows supplies many benefits, including:
- Energy Efficiency: Modern doors and windows are designed with energy-efficient materials and innovations, minimizing heating and cooling expenses.
- Improved Security: Quality doors and windows include innovative locking mechanisms that provide safety against invasions.
- Aesthetic Appeal: A broad variety of styles and finishes is readily available, permitting homeowners to improve the appearance of their residential or commercial property.
- Increased Property Value: Upgraded doors and windows can significantly increase a home's market price.
- Sound Reduction: Quality items can reduce external noise, creating a more serene indoor environment.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
To maximize the life expectancy of windows and doors, regular upkeep is essential. Here are some useful ideas:
- Cleaning: Use non-abrasive cleaners to prevent damaging the surface area. Regular cleansing avoids dust and dirt build-up.
- Examining Seals: Check seals for wear and replace them if necessary to preserve insulation efficiency.
- Lubrication: Regularly lube moving parts such as hinges and locks to ensure smooth operation.
- Painting/Staining: Maintain the visual value by repainting or staining wood frames as needed.
- Expert Checks: Schedule professional evaluations every couple of years to recognize prospective issues.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How do I pick the right doors and windows for my home?
Selecting the ideal products depends upon several aspects, consisting of climate, architectural design, energy performance rankings, and your budget.
2. What products are doors and windows made from?
Common materials consist of w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ass. Each features its own benefits and downsides.
3. How typically should windows and doors be changed?
The lifespan of doors and windows can vary, however normally, they ought to be replaced every 15 to 30 years, depending upon the material quality and maintenance.
4. Can I install windows and doors myself?
While DIY setup is possible, hiring specialists makes sure right installation and compliance with regional building regulations.
5. What should I look for in a windows and doors company?
Try to find accreditation, experience, consumer evaluations, warranties, and a wide selection of products to discover a reliable company.
